Exactly what syncs, and how often
No hand-waving about "POS data." This is the actual connection screen's worth of detail: five data streams, their cadence, and what each one powers.
| Data stream | What flows | Cadence | Powers |
|---|---|---|---|
| Product catalog | Every product with image, brand, price, category, and a first-seen date, so “new” means new to your store, not new to a template library. | Nightly, in your store’s timezone | New-product grids, new-brand alerts, brand spotlights |
| Batch expiry | METRC batch expiry dates per product: which units will age out, and how many will not sell through at current velocity. | Nightly | Expiring-product flash sales, ranked by units at risk |
| Restock events | Products that just ended a multi-day zero-stock streak, with how long they were gone. | Nightly snapshot comparison | Honest back-in-stock emails (“back after 12 days away”) |
| Ticket lines | Completed tickets, line by line, joined to customer email: items, quantities, discounts, in-store vs pickup. | Nightly; completed tickets only | Best-seller proof lines, purchase segments, revenue attribution |
| Customers & tickets feed | Customer emails and phones with full ticket history and order source. License and medical fields are dropped at ingestion. We never store them. | Nightly; first backfill ≈ 10 minutes | Win-back detection, send-time analysis, segment substance |
Read-only. Every request is HMAC-signed. The nightly job runs in your store’s timezone at roughly 10–25 small API calls per day. Your registers and menu never feel it.
What the Treez feed unlocks
Each stream above maps to specific auto-generated campaigns and reports. All of these are live today:
New products, ranked by velocity
One live store surfaced 395 genuinely new products in a 30-day window. The suggested email led with the fastest seller’s photo and laid the rest out in a price-tagged card grid with menu deep links.
Expiring-product flash sales
Batch expiry dates plus actual sell-through rates tell us which products won’t clear in time. The suggestion feed drafts the flash sale while there’s still time to move them, ranked by units at risk.
Back-in-stock emails
Restock detection catches products returning from a multi-day zero-stock streak, so the email can honestly say “back after 12 days away” instead of pretending it never left.
Best sellers with receipts
Revenue-ranked photo cards computed from real ticket lines. Proof lines like “203 sold this month” come from the register, not a merchandiser’s hunch.
Win-back, with the segment built for you
Lapsed-regular detection found 899 overdue customers at one store, then auto-created the matching segment, so the win-back campaign was one review away from sending.
Best time to send
A 7×24 histogram over 25,000+ of your own tickets, in your store’s timezone, tells the send wizard when your customers actually shop: “Friday early afternoon,” not a generic best practice.
Purchase-rule segments
Purchased (or didn’t) within N days, spend over $X in 90 days, X+ purchases in a window. These are segments built from tickets, which no click-based tool can see.
POS revenue attribution
Buyers, tickets, and register-verified revenue per campaign in 1, 7, and 14-day windows, with named buyer rows and in-store vs pickup splits. Completed tickets only, never estimates.

And the generic-ESP route?
Klaviyo and Mailchimp have no native Treez connector, so a Treez store on a generic ESP is really running a CSV-upload workflow with extra steps: no batch expiry, no restock detection, no ticket-level attribution, and a compliance posture that ranges from "email tolerated" (Klaviyo, which bans cannabis SMS outright) to genuinely risky account-freeze territory. Add shared sending IPs and you inherit someone else's reputation, which is exactly why we run dedicated IPs per store on infrastructure approved with full cannabis disclosure.
